5 things to do in your Quail Valley home while you wait
Only if it's safe. Don't risk electrocution or injury.
Stop the source
Shut the water main at the meter or where the main enters the home. Every minute of running water adds damage.
Cut electrical power
Power off at the breaker to the affected area if water is near outlets. Don't walk through standing water near energized electrical.
Move what you can
Lift rugs, get furniture legs on blocks or foil, raise electronics and important papers off the floor.
Document everything
Phone-camera photos and short videos of the water and damaged items support your insurance claim.
Don't shop-vac standing water
Most household vacs aren't rated for water and create a shock hazard. Wait for truck-mounted extraction.

What we see most often on Quail Valley extraction calls
Quail Valley's unique failure patterns
Quail Valley homes built in the 1970s present recurring water-damage scenarios different from newer subdivisions: slab leaks where hot-water supply lines corrode through, cast-iron drain stacks that collapse from the inside after 40+ years, and aging galvanized supply lines that develop pinhole leaks at fittings. We arrive with thermal cameras and acoustic listening equipment so source diagnosis happens in the first hour rather than the first day.
Slab leak + extraction in one call
When water surfaces from a slab leak, the visible damage is one room but the source is buried under concrete. We extract surface water immediately while the slab leak is located with calibrated equipment. Plumber gets called in once the precise location is known, minimizing the demolition scope.
